Judul ArtikelPENGARUH STARVASI TERHADAP KEMAMPUAN MIGRASI SEL PUNCA
MESENKIMAL TALI PUSAT MANUSIA DENGAN METODE SCRATCH ASSAY
Abstrak (Bhs. Indonesia)Latar Belakang: Terapi sel punca mesenkimal (SPM) tali pusat manusia tengah
berkembang pesat. Namun, masih terdapat tantangan terapi seperti proliferasi dan migrasi
yang tidak terkendali. Sehingga, media terkondisi SPM sebagai upaya untuk meminimalisir
tantangan tersebut melalui sinkronisasi siklus sel sebelum transplantasi. Tujuan: Penelitian
ini bertujuan untuk mengetahui pengaruh starvasi terhadap kemampuan SPM tali pusat
manusia terhadap kemampuan migrasi dengan metode scratch assay. Metodologi: penelitian
eksperimental dengan pendekatan “post test only with control group” dengan sampel berupa
gambar area migrasi dari mikroskop inversi sebanyak 4 lapang pandang disetiap kelompok
perlakuan, yaitu kelompok media komplit pada DMEM+FBS (MK), starvasi serum pada
media DMEM only (BASAL) dan starvasi asam amino pada media HBSS (HBSS). Serta
pengambilan gambar menurut durasi starvasi. Perlakuan diulang sebanyak 1 kali.
Kuantifikasi luas penutupan migrasi SPM menggunakan software ImageJ. Analisis data
menggunakan One-Way ANOVA. Hasil: Terdapat perbedaan yang signifikan (p<0,05)
kemampuan migrasi SPM didalam 3 kelompok pada jam ke-4 dan 8. Terdapat perbedaan
yang signifikan (p<0,05) rerata kemampuan migrasi SPM pada media BASAL dan HBSS
disetiap periode durasi starvasi. Kesimpulan: Kemampuan migrasi pada kelompok HBSS
lebih lambat dibandingkan kelompok lainnya. Durasi starvasi terbaik pada tiga kelompok
media pada jam ke-4 dan 8.
Kata kunci: Migrasi, Sel punca mesenkimal, Siklus sel, starvasi
Abtrak (Bhs. Inggris)Background: Human umbilical mesenchymal stem cell (hUMSC) therapy is rapidly
advancing. However, challenges persist in therapeutic applications, such as uncontrolled
proliferation and migration. Thus, conditioned media for stem cells has been explored as a
means to minimize these challenges by synchronizing the cell cycle prior to transplantation.
Objective: This study aims to investigate the effect of starvation on the migration ability of
human umbilical mesenchymal stem cells (hUMSCs) using the scratch assay method.
Methodology: An experimental study with a "post-test only with control group" approach
was conducted, with samples consisting of migration area images taken from an inverted
microscope at four different fields of view for each treatment group, namely the complete
media group in DMEM+FBS (MK), serum starvation in DMEM only (BASAL), andasam
amino starvation in HBSS media (HBSS). Images were captured according to the starvation
duration, and treatments were repeated once. Migration area quantification was performed
using ImageJ software. Data analysis was conducted using One-Way ANOVA. Results: A
significant difference (p<0.05) in migration ability was observed in the three groups at the
4th and 8th hours. A significant difference (p<0.05) in the average migration ability of
hUMSCs was noted in the BASAL and HBSS media across different starvation durations.
Conclusion: The migration ability in the HBSS group was slower compared to the other
groups. The optimal starvation duration across all media groups was observed at the 4th
and 8th hours.
Keywords: Cell cycle, Mesenchymal stem cells, Migration, Starvation
